I-94 is only needed to be held by NON-Immigrants, after adjusting status and getting the green-card, the I-94 can be removed and discarded.

Usually if AOS results in an interview the interviewing officer MAY take the card, if the AOS was approved without an interview, you can remove it and either toss it or put it in your visa journey scrapbook.

Note: When traveling abroad and re-entering the USA using the green-card you do not have to fill out an I-94.
